Table 1 Risk factors, mechanisms, and clinical manifestations of dyslipidemia in cirrhosis
| Risk factor | Pathophysiological mechanisms | Clinical manifestations | Ref. |
| Cardiometabolic comorbidities (diabetes, hypertension, obesity, MASLD) | (1) Insulin resistance promotes hepatic de novo lipogenesis and VLDL secretion; (2) Adipokine imbalance (↑leptin, ↓adiponectin); and (3) PNPLA3 and TM6SF2 variants impair triglyceride mobilization and VLDL secretion, fostering steatosis and atherogenic dyslipidemia | (1) Overlap of MetS and cirrhosis (up to 60% of patients); and (2) Central obesity, hypertriglyceridemia and low HDL-C accelerate fibrosis and CV events (“liver-heart-metabolism” axis) | [4,20,24-26,37-41] |
| Hepatic dysfunction and impaired lipid handling | (1) Loss of hepatocyte mass reduces apolipoprotein synthesis (ApoA-I and ApoB), VLDL secretion and LDL receptor activity to ↓total cholesterol, LDL-C, HDL-C; and (2) Cholestasis to paradoxical hypertriglyceridemia (impaired LPL activity) | (1) In compensated cirrhosis: Modest lipid reductions and near-normal TG; (2) In decompensated cirrhosis: Lowest TC and HDL-C in Child-Pugh C; and (3) Hypocholesterolemia predicts poor survival and transplant-free mortality | [8,9,11,20-23,28,31-33] |
| Chronic systemic inflammation and viral/metabolic injury | (1) Oxidative LDL uptake by Kupffer cells to cytokine release (TNF-α, IL-6); (2) Stellate cell activation to fibrosis; (3) HCV alters VLDL assembly and lowers LDL-C; (4) MASLD dyslipidemia promotes lipotoxicity and carcinogenesis; and (5) Lipidomic signatures in HCC | (1) Increased sd-LDL and oxidized LDL despite low absolute LDL-C; (2) Paradoxical ↑CAD incidence in cirrhosis; and (3) Dyslipidemia linked to fibrogenesis, HCC risk and extra-hepatic morbidity | [24,25,27,29,30,34-36,41] |
